Web3 Jan 2024 · Sensitivity in finance refers to the extent of a market instrument’s responsiveness to changes in underlying factors, most commonly in terms of price … WebThe SOT measures how the EVE responds to an instantaneous parallel (up and down) yield curve shift of 200 basis points. Changes in EVE that exceed 20% of the institution’s own funds will trigger supervisory discussions and may lead to additional capital requirements. Some changes to the SOT were included in the 2024 update of the IRRBB Guidelines. Sensitivity analysis is the study of how the uncertainty in the output of a mathematical model or system (numerical or otherwise) can be divided and allocated to different sources of uncertainty in its inputs. [1] [2] A related practice is uncertainty analysis, which has a greater focus on uncertainty quantification and propagation of ... In contrast, scenario analysis requires one to list the … fake gold bamboo earringsWeb27 Jan 2024 · The European Central Bank (ECB) today launched a supervisory climate risk stress test to assess how prepared banks are for dealing with financial and economic shocks stemming from climate risk. The exercise will be conducted in the first half of 2024 after which the ECB will publish aggregate results.
